Transaction a6cc59d2a278fa0782838f990db888e287d160cdb9d582fcccdb8e9b386b6a56

1 Input
2 Outputs
  • a6cc59d2a278fa0782838f990db888e287d160cdb9d582fcccdb8e9b386b6a56:0
  • value  18891684
    address  33wKqYmR6PLZajyboWGeUp8YCQUXiU6gt7
  • a6cc59d2a278fa0782838f990db888e287d160cdb9d582fcccdb8e9b386b6a56:1
  • value  328674
    address  358HDFA2un1PnhBjcFLzcBsNyKuSbwz1Ki